Doctorate of Business Administration (DBA): A Comprehensive Guide

The Doctorate of Business Administration (DBA) is a prestigious advanced degree designed for professionals seeking to elevate their expertise in business management and leadership. Unlike a Ph.D., which focuses on theoretical research, a DBA emphasizes practical application, making it ideal for executives, consultants, and entrepreneurs aiming to solve real-world business challenges.

Why Pursue a DBA?

A DBA offers numerous benefits, including:

  • Career Advancement: A DBA can open doors to senior leadership roles, such as CEO, CFO, or management consultant.
  • Specialized Knowledge: Gain in-depth expertise in areas like strategic management, organizational behavior, and innovation.
  • Networking Opportunities: Connect with industry leaders, academics, and peers from around the globe.
  • Higher Earning Potential: DBA graduates often command higher salaries due to their advanced qualifications.
